Sundays
The heart of our church life is our worship of God on a Sunday when we meet at 11am and 6.30pm. We meet for approximately for one hour.
Communion is celebrated on the first evening and third morning of the month. We welcome all those who love our Lord Jesus Christ and seek to follow him, to receive the elements of bread and wine.
Family worship is in the morning. All meet together then separate into appropriate age groups. A crèche is available for the very young. Parade services are held monthly when all the uniformed groups are invited to attend and encouraged to participate. We seek to involve people and use both traditional and contemporary music during our worship.
The evening service is smaller in attendance and a quieter act of worship.
